There is a complexity associated with home networking, howbeit, there is an important aspect that you need to consider before making a purchase.

The cable can either be STP or UTP. STP means SHIELDED TWISTED PAIR, it is bundled inside a rubber sleeve with no other protection. UTP means Unshielded Twisted Pair and is the most common. STP is more expensive compared to UTP

Theoretically, UTP supports 100 meters long between the host or switch. If you need longer cables you will require powered switches.

Category 5 Ethernet Cables (Cat 5E)

This is the worst king of ethernet cabling that you will find in the Kenyan market, theoretically, it supports 100mbps. It uses 2 of the 4 pair wires. Do not purchase cat 5 unless you need to run a long bit of cable at low bandwidth.

Category 5e Network Cables

Cat 5e (e is the enhanced version), which decreases crosstalk and thus enables a speed of up to 1000mbps (Gigabit Ethernet). It is the most common kind of cable that you will find today and is adequate for home use.

Category 6 LAN Ethernet Cables -Gigabit Speeds

Cat 6 handles up to 10 gigabits theoretically at a maximum length of 37m and is complete overkill for home use.

CAT5e vs CAT6

An ethernet cable is graded by the speed of data it can transfer, CAT5e and CAT6 both support Gigabit ethernet (1000mbs) as well as lower speeds,

CAT6 has a tighter twist in the wire pairs which allows 10 Gigabit networking over distances up to 50m and 2-way communication on each pair of wires, the tighter twist also provides better noise immunity which in turn leads to lower delay and skew.

Cat6  has a further tightening of the wire twist and adds a shield, this allows 10 Gigabit networking up to circa 100m.

For typical home use such as connecting a router to a smart TV, a Cat 5e Ethernet cable is more than adequate as the limiting factor will be your broadband speed, for HDMI over Ethernet we recommend using CAT 6 full copper.
